Over the last week while I did not have my head buried in all my websites, I sat back a bit to look at the whole online business thingy and it all looked quite daunting to me again…

While I make a nice 2k now every month, I still struggle like mad sometimes to hit the mark. You see, we always need to be on top of our game and keep on our toes all the time. Even small things like checking to see if your graphics are loading when your website loads are all important things that need to be done.

I’ve had a tough time this month trying to hit the 2k mark even after launching a new membership website and running an Easter Promotion. The new membership website only managed 3 new signups and the Easter Promotion has brought me 6 sign ups. This time I ran a different promotion offering a free 7 day trial which would only benefit me if they found any value in my service. So I need to wait 7 days to see any money!!

I’ve just checked my sales so far on Paypal confirmed that I am struggling…HELP!

Month to date sales is just $1437.04 and this is before paying Paypal commissions! So we’ll see if any of the 6 sign ups stay on to make my grand total 2k. I’ll need at least 5 of them to stay on to hit 2k but I also have other products that should help a bit! lol… tough… this month since the bar was raised to 2k last month.

You see it is always a work in progress, even the big guns have this ‘problem’. It is not so much a problem for them as they have an army of affiliates to promote their stuff for them and this is really where I am lacking. I have no affiliates and have not even bothered recuiting any affiliates. Even with an army of affiliates, they still need to keep coming out with new products and new promotions for their affiliates because affiliates sell the lastest hottest products or best paying ones.

This month has been a real challenge for me as I had expected and I think I’ll just barely get by. I’ve taken steps to try to stablelise the recurring income from my 2 membership sites that really depend on me to perform. If my selections under peform like they did in February then I few members drop out and I need to look for new ones and that is a problem. It is always better to keep your customers happy than to find new ones.

The most important lesson learnt this month is to have more $7 websites. The total passive income generated from my two $7 websites is only $154 and another more expensive product is $403, making the total of $557.92. So you see the bulk of my income is from the membership websites, I need to have an equal balance.

So that is my mission for April… another 1 or 2 products that require little or no daily maintenance work.
